Remarks:
The Pegasus 800 remains an ever popular Broads and coastal sailing cruiser/racer. This very well equipped example is an extremely desirable wing keel, fractional rig version, ideal for Broads cruising. She appears to be in good order throughout, and is sadly for sale use to a change of circumstances.
MOORING: It’s understood that the vessel’s current mooring (in what is arguably one of the best locations on the northern Broads!) could be transferred to the purchaser. The mooring fee has been paid for 2016 (approximately £810pa).
